数据库 · 11 11 月, 2024

數據庫信息匹配添加:實現更高效的數據管理 (數據庫信息匹配添加)

數據庫信息匹配添加:實現更高效的數據管理

在當今數據驅動的世界中,數據庫的管理和優化變得越來越重要。隨著企業和組織積累的數據量不斷增加,如何有效地管理和利用這些數據成為了一個關鍵挑戰。數據庫信息匹配添加技術的出現,為解決這一問題提供了新的思路和方法。

什麼是數據庫信息匹配添加?

數據庫信息匹配添加是指在數據庫中根據特定的匹配規則,將新數據與現有數據進行比對,並根據比對結果進行數據的添加或更新。這一過程不僅能夠提高數據的準確性,還能夠減少重複數據的產生,從而提升數據庫的整體效率。

數據庫信息匹配添加的必要性

  • 數據準確性:隨著數據量的增加,數據的準確性變得至關重要。通過信息匹配,可以有效地檢測和消除錯誤數據。
  • 減少重複數據:重複數據不僅浪費存儲空間,還可能導致分析結果的偏差。信息匹配能夠幫助識別和合併重複的數據條目。
  • 提高查詢效率:通過優化數據結構,信息匹配可以提高查詢的速度,從而提升用戶體驗。

如何實現數據庫信息匹配添加

實現數據庫信息匹配添加的過程通常包括以下幾個步驟:

1. 定義匹配規則

首先,需要根據業務需求定義匹配規則。這些規則可以基於數據的特徵,如名稱、地址、電話號碼等。例如,對於客戶數據,可以設置一個規則,當兩個客戶的姓名和電話號碼相同時,則認為這是重複數據。

2. 數據清洗

在進行匹配之前,對數據進行清洗是必要的。這包括去除空值、標準化格式(如日期格式、電話號碼格式等)以及刪除不必要的字符。

3. 實施匹配算法

根據定義的匹配規則,選擇合適的匹配算法。常見的算法包括基於字符串相似度的算法(如Levenshtein距離)、基於機器學習的算法等。以下是一個簡單的Python示例,使用Levenshtein距離來計算字符串相似度:

from Levenshtein import distance

def is_match(str1, str2, threshold=3):
    return distance(str1, str2) <= threshold

# 示例
print(is_match("香港", "香港"))  # 返回 True 或 False

4. 數據添加或更新

根據匹配結果,將新數據添加到數據庫中,或更新現有數據。這一過程需要確保數據的一致性和完整性。

結論

數據庫信息匹配添加技術在現代數據管理中扮演著重要角色。通過有效的匹配和添加過程,企業能夠提高數據的準確性,減少重複數據,並提升查詢效率。隨著技術的進步,未來的數據庫管理將會更加智能化和自動化。

如果您對於如何在您的業務中實施這些技術有興趣,或者想了解更多關於 香港VPS雲伺服器 的信息,請訪問我們的網站以獲取更多資源。